Background

Jello shots became widely popular in the 1960s as a playful way to serve alcohol in a portable format. Cherry quickly became one of the most recognizable versions thanks to its bright color and crowd-pleasing flavor, making it a staple at parties, tailgates, and casual gatherings.

Helpful Tips

  • Fully dissolve gelatin before adding alcohol
  • Do not add vodka to boiling liquid
  • Chill long enough to fully set before serving
  • Keep refrigerated until ready to serve

Directions

  1. Bring water to a boil.

  2. Add cherry Jello to a heat-safe bowl and pour in boiling water. Stir until fully dissolved.

  3. Add vodka and cold water. Stir gently to combine.

  4. Pour the mixture into shot glasses or small cups.

  5. Refrigerate for 2–4 hours, or until fully set.

  6. Serve chilled.
